Tran says that -1/4x-7+9/4x+2x id equalvalent to 4x-7. How can substituting any value for x help you determine whether Tran is correct? Is Tran correct? Use substition to justify your answer

Answer:

You can determine if Tran is correct by substituting any value to "x" into each expression. If the values obtained are equal, then the expressions are equivalent.

Yes, Tran is correct (See explanation).

Step-by-step explanation:

By definition, equivalent expressions havee the same value.

In this case, given the expression:

[tex]-\frac{1}{4}x-7+\frac{9}{4}x+2x[/tex]

And the expression:

[tex]4x-7[/tex]

We can determine if they are equivalent by giving any value to "x", substituting into each expression and evaluate. If the values obtained are equal, then the expressions are equivalent.

To check if Tran is correct, we can give the following value to "x":

[tex]x=1[/tex]

Substituting this value into the expression [tex]-\frac{1}{4}x-7+\frac{9}{4}x+2x[/tex], we get:

[tex]-\frac{1}{4}(1)-7+\frac{9}{4}(1)+2(1)=-3[/tex]

Substituting [tex]x=1[/tex] into the expression [tex]4x-7[/tex], we get:

[tex]4(1)-7=-3[/tex]

Therefore, we can conclude that Tran is correct.
